“Celebrating history” is the theme of the Historical Association’s annual conference and AGM at the Wallace Collection, Hertford House, Manchester Square, London W1, April 5. The programme comprises a range of lectures and guided visits around the treasures of the collection, which includes French 18th-century pictures, 17th-century pictures and an impressive armoury. Lectures include: Hadrian’s Wall; and “War means Whisky! Liquor control and the Carlisle experiment, 1915-21”. Parallel sessions will be run on Border history, the loss of the American colonies, ICT and history and the French Revolution together with guided visits.
